menu
{ "item_title" : "Mastering PyQt", "item_author" : [" Williams Asiedu "], "item_description" : "Mastering PyQt: Fast Application Development with Python and PyQt is your essential guide to designing and developing robust desktop applications with a professional finish. This hands-on book covers both Python foundations and in-depth PyQt usage, making it perfect for both newcomers and experienced developers wanting to sharpen their GUI skills.Readers will learn everything from setting up Python and understanding GUI concepts to advanced PyQt widget usage and application packaging. With clear explanations, practical examples, and step-by-step projects, you'll gain the confidence to create modern, user-friendly software.Key Features:Python setup and fundamentals for absolute beginnersComprehensive coverage of PyQt widgets, layouts, and design principlesIntegration of menus, toolbars, dialogs, and mediaAdvanced styling with CSS and custom drawing with QPainterPackaging your applications for Windows, macOS, and LinuxHands-on Projects Included:Building a Simple Calculator with core widgetsDesigning a Login Page with input validationDeveloping a feature-rich English App with dictionary lookup, spelling correction, tokenization, pluralization, and noun phrase extractionCreating a Music Player App with audio file selection, playback, and progress monitoringEach chapter offers code examples, notes, tips, and in-depth views to guide your learning. By the end of this book, you'll be able to design, develop, and package professional-grade desktop applications-all in Python.Whether you're an instructor, student, hobbyist, or software engineer, Mastering PyQt is your gateway to building beautiful and functional desktop applications, faster than ever.", "item_img_path" : "https://covers1.booksamillion.com/covers/bam/9/79/834/947/9798349474088_b.jpg", "price_data" : { "retail_price" : "48.75", "online_price" : "48.75", "our_price" : "48.75", "club_price" : "48.75", "savings_pct" : "0", "savings_amt" : "0.00", "club_savings_pct" : "0", "club_savings_amt" : "0.00", "discount_pct" : "10", "store_price" : "" } }
Mastering PyQt|Williams Asiedu

Mastering PyQt : Build Fast, Modern Applications with Python

local_shippingShip to Me
In Stock.
FREE Shipping for Club Members help

Overview

Mastering PyQt: Fast Application Development with Python and PyQt is your essential guide to designing and developing robust desktop applications with a professional finish. This hands-on book covers both Python foundations and in-depth PyQt usage, making it perfect for both newcomers and experienced developers wanting to sharpen their GUI skills.

Readers will learn everything from setting up Python and understanding GUI concepts to advanced PyQt widget usage and application packaging. With clear explanations, practical examples, and step-by-step projects, you'll gain the confidence to create modern, user-friendly software.

Key Features:

  • Python setup and fundamentals for absolute beginners
  • Comprehensive coverage of PyQt widgets, layouts, and design principles
  • Integration of menus, toolbars, dialogs, and media
  • Advanced styling with CSS and custom drawing with QPainter
  • Packaging your applications for Windows, macOS, and Linux

Hands-on Projects Included:

Building a Simple Calculator with core widgets

Designing a Login Page with input validation

Developing a feature-rich English App with dictionary lookup, spelling correction, tokenization, pluralization, and noun phrase extraction

Creating a Music Player App with audio file selection, playback, and progress monitoring

Each chapter offers code examples, notes, tips, and in-depth views to guide your learning. By the end of this book, you'll be able to design, develop, and package professional-grade desktop applications-all in Python.

Whether you're an instructor, student, hobbyist, or software engineer, Mastering PyQt is your gateway to building beautiful and functional desktop applications, faster than ever.

This item is Non-Returnable

Details

  • ISBN-13: 9798349474088
  • ISBN-10: 9798349474088
  • Publisher: Ouereila Publishing House
  • Publish Date: July 2025
  • Dimensions: 11 x 8.5 x 0.86 inches
  • Shipping Weight: 2.14 pounds
  • Page Count: 422

Related Categories

You May Also Like...

    1

BAM Customer Reviews